What is a remote no experience game developer?

A remote no experience game developer is someone who works on designing, coding, or testing video games from a remote location, such as home, without prior professional experience in the gaming industry. These roles are often entry-level and may focus on simple tasks, learning through mentorship, or participating in training programs provided by game studios. Companies may look for candidates who have a passion for gaming, basic programming knowledge, and a willingness to learn on the job. Remote positions provide flexibility and are suited for those starting out in game development who want to build skills and a portfolio.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a remote no experience game developer?

To thrive as a Remote No Experience Game Developer, you should have a basic understanding of programming concepts (such as C# or JavaScript), a passion for gaming, and a willingness to learn, even if you lack formal qualifications. Familiarity with beginner-friendly game engines like Unity or Godot, and using online learning platforms or certifications, is common for those starting out. Creativity, strong problem-solving abilities, self-motivation, and effective communication are important soft skills for remote collaboration and ongoing development. These skills and qualities are crucial for quickly learning industry practices, building a portfolio, and contributing effectively to game development projects from a remote setting.

What are some common challenges faced by remote, entry-level game developers and how can they be overcome?

Remote, entry-level game developers often face challenges such as limited access to mentorship, difficulty in understanding team workflows, and the need to proactively communicate progress or questions. To overcome these obstacles, it's important to regularly participate in team meetings, use project management tools to track tasks, and seek feedback from more experienced colleagues through chat or video calls. Building a habit of clear communication and actively engaging with the team can help new remote developers integrate effectively and continue learning.

What is the difference between Remote No Experience Game Developer vs Remote No Experience Game Designer?

AspectRemote No Experience Game DeveloperRemote No Experience Game Designer
Required CredentialsBasic understanding of game development tools, coding fundamentalsCreative skills, understanding of game mechanics, basic design tools
Work EnvironmentCollaborative with developers, programmers, and technical teamsCreative teams, artists, and narrative designers
Industry UsageCommon entry point for aspiring developers in gaming companiesEntry-level role for those interested in game concept and visual design
Search & Comparison IntentPeople looking to start a career in game development with no experienceIndividuals interested in game design roles without prior experience

While both roles are entry-level and require minimal experience, a Remote No Experience Game Developer focuses on coding and technical development, whereas a Remote No Experience Game Designer emphasizes creativity and game concept development. Understanding these differences helps job seekers target the right roles based on their skills and interests.
